Shift: Thursday-Sunday (7:00am - 530pm)

You will...

  • Drive continuous development to production, quality, cost, and delivery initiatives while building and

maintaining relationships with hourly associates, managers, carrier partners, vendors, and various

departments within HelloFresh

  • Oversee the day-to-day production operations, ensuring on-time and accurate delivery of customer

orders

  • Effectively engage, coach, motivate and lead the Production team for career progression and

development

  • Monitor communication between multiple production lines to eliminate downtime
  • Establish procedures, metrics and processes to drive productivity and optimization
  • Analyze and identify areas of improvement in cost savings, production, and lead times
  • Develop and administer operational procedures for outgoing shipments, handling and disposition of

products, and keeping the highest standards of quality

  • Create, learn, and assist on strategic planning and forecasting to improve existing production issues
  • Establish new procedures, metrics, and processes alongside the COO and Director of Operations
  • Develop and administer operational procedures for executing activities for outgoing shipments, handling

and disposition of products, and keeping the highest standards of Quality

  • Create a positive team dynamic that encourages all employees to provide feedback and drive change

within the facility, adapt to the ever-changing business, and stay focused on the customer experience

You are...

  • Bold: you are a true entrepreneurial spirit and not afraid to take calculated risks to disrupt the status quo;

you're a visionary leader that listens to your team and values their ideas

  • Analytical: data is your friend; you're able to translate numbers into action and pave the way for efficiency
  • Strategic: you recognize and resolve situations that are ambiguous or challenging, focus effort on meeting

or exceeding goals, and pave the way for efficiency

  • Problem-solver: you have a knack for production planning and are a critical thinker who uses logic to

identify alternatives and present solutions to complex problems while thinking in terms of contingency

plans

  • Customer-focused: slightly obsessive-compulsive when it comes to customer experience and strive to

deliver a product that is second to none

You have....

  • Bachelor’s degree Required, diploma or GED required
  • 5+ years of operational leadership in food manufacturing/production plant
  • Prior experience in direct to consumer fulfillment / eCommerce operations
  • Understanding of food safety regulations/compliance (SQF, HACCP, AIB, BRC)
  • Proven success managing teams of 100+ employees in a hyper-growth organization - our culture is a

critical part of our success, and you need to help drive it

  • Effective project management skills, well-versed in Lean Manufacturing/Continuous Improvement (Six

Sigma, APICS, Kaizen certification a plus)

  • Efficient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, Power Point) and Google app (Gmail, drive, sheets, etc.)

capabilities
